Reviewer's Bio

Chris Beeching

  I blame my Father for sullying my life with audio and music. A keen amateur viola player, and audio lover, music was always being played at home, either live, or recorded. He also tainted my aesthetic by having the original Quad valve gear, which has retained a place in my audio heart ever since. Flawed it may be (in some respects) but it still makes music.

I graduated with an Honors Degree in music, with the organ being my main instrument. I then worked for EMI in London on the classical promotions side meeting many great performers and also spending a large amount of time in recording studios and at EMI-sponsored concerts.

I also became heavily involved with Jackdaws (as Company Secretary), a Music Education Charity based in Somerset, UK, founded to make music teaching of excellence available to those who might not otherwise be able to benefit from it. It now also boasts a prestigious Singing Competition, and has spawned a world premiere recording, and runs music holidays as well.

Career in writing started in about 1976, and since then has included Hi-Fi News, Jazz on CD, Audiophile, Classic CD, Listener, Hi-Fi World, plus a whole host of other odd bits and pieces here and there.

Four children make two lounges a necessity, giving me the peace and quiet to spend time with my music, (and as long as it's good music, that's fine by me) leaving the kids to do their thing in the other lounge. Current system is in the low-power-amp-high-efficiency-speaker arena, but also run a Naim system in the spare room. Still collecting records... and CDs occasionally. Music preference; classical and jazz, but no closed doors really!

I still play real music, and have raised funds for local charities by playing jazz gigs with my two brothers plus a few 'add-ons'.

My ultimate goal in life... to encourage many many more people to make time to really sit down and enjoy music.
